Been back and forth with 03bamaGT a few times. Captured it all on video.
First race is a dig. Neither of us hooked too well. I got him out of the hole (driver mod) but he walked me down.

http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=D5gxVZUazLo

Next race is a 30 roll, right on top of my power band. Spooled up and showed him what was up with the 7M.

http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=OR_tkqwxZ0c

tbh, I really don't understand why the two races were so diffrent. On the dig, he steadily pulled me and on the roll, I steadily puled him. I guess it has to do with fuel delivery and just spool. In both races, we lifted (as agreed) at 110 ish. Can anyone make sense of the different outcomes?

What happened at the beginning of the first video? Was that a bad start, and you guys had to redo it? Or did he launch good on you, and decided to give you another chance?

If you got him out of the hole and he still managed to walk you like that? You were even in second gear at the top of his first. He even rolled out of first like he's going to bingo sunday, and granny shifted his ass off. He came from your rear bumper and put an easy two car lengths on you. He obviously has the faster car.

Second race you were in your sweet spot. He probably wasn't. You pulled a car on him, and barely started to pull away. Lower drag coefficient maybe? You weren't leaving him really bad. It's not like you came from a car deficit and pulled two to three cars on him.
